Output 81066174d95a6cf08162f55922c595b510545e64d863f7880d7e0b50f429b7b4:4

value
2465152
script pubkey
OP_0 OP_PUSHBYTES_20 708f45c2f18af3fc379b55a079d24bfc05a7542c
address
bc1qwz85tsh33telcdum2ks8n5jtlsz6w4pvpdxcrz
transaction
81066174d95a6cf08162f55922c595b510545e64d863f7880d7e0b50f429b7b4
spent
true